Here's an overview of the environment and water testing:

Water Quality Testing:

  • Chemical Parameters: These tests assess the presence and concentration of various chemicals, such as pH, dissolved oxygen, turbidity, conductivity, and nutrients (nitrogen and phosphorus). High levels of nutrients can lead to eutrophication and algal blooms in water bodies.
  • Microbiological Parameters: Testing for the presence of fecal coliforms, E. coli, and other pathogenic microorganisms is crucial to ensure safe drinking water and recreational water quality.
  • Heavy Metals: Detecting heavy metals like lead, arsenic, mercury, and cadmium is essential because they can be toxic to humans and aquatic life.
  • Organic Compounds: Identifying organic contaminants such as pesticides, herbicides, pharmaceuticals, and volatile organic compounds (VOCs) helps in assessing water safety.

Environmental Sampling and Analysis:

 

  • Air Quality Testing: This involves monitoring pollutants in the air, including particulate matter (PM2.5 and PM10), ozone (O3), sulfur dioxide (SO2), nitrogen oxides (NOx), carbon monoxide (CO), and volatile organic compounds (VOCs).
  • Soil Testing: Assessing soil quality for parameters like pH, organic matter content, nutrient levels, and the presence of contaminants such as heavy metals, pesticides, and hydrocarbons.
  • Food Testing : Food testing is an important process in the food industry to ensure compliance of food products with safety, quality and regulatory standards. It includes a variety of techniques and methods for analyzing food samples for various factors including chemical composition, microbiological contamination, sensory properties, nutritional content and labeling accuracy.
  • Indoor Air Quality Testing: Indoor air quality (IAQ) testing is the process of assessing and analyzing the quality of air inside a building or enclosed space to determine if it meets established standards for human health and comfort. Poor indoor air quality can lead to various health issues, including respiratory problems, allergies, and discomfort.
